Britain banned the export of banknotes to Belarus

In addition to banknotes, Britain also banned the EXPORT of industrial equipment and dual-use goods to Belarus. There is also a banfor the import of Belarusian gold, cement,wood and rubber

London's new package of sanctions against MINSK includes a ban on the export of banknotes, industrial equipment, dual-use goods and technologies. In addition, a ban is being introduced on the import of gold, cement, timber and rubber from Belarus, the British Foreign Office said.

“This new package increases the economic pressure on [Belarusian President Alexander] Lukashenko and his regime, which is actively facilitating the Russian war effort and ignoring the territorial integrity of Ukraine,” British Foreign Secretary James Cleverley said in a statement ( quoted by REUTERS ) .

After the outbreak of hostilities in Ukraine , a number of countries imposed sanctions not only against RUSSIA, but also against Belarus, explaining this by the fact that Minsk supports Moscow in the conflict.

Lukashenka has repeatedly assured that the Belarusian army does not take part in the Russian military operation, and ruled out an attack from Minsk. At the same time, in early October last year, he said that Belarus was taking part in the Russian military operation in Ukraine, but was not sending its military to the combat zone. “We don't kill anyone. We don't send our military anywhere. We do not violate our obligations,” the Belarusian president said.

According to Lukashenka, the goal of Minsk is to prevent the spread of the armed conflict to Belarus and to prevent a strike on its territory "under the guise of a special military operation from Poland, Lithuania and Latvia."

In addition, at the end of March, Russian President Vladimir Putin announced that Moscow would deploy its tactical nuclear weapons (TNW) in Belarus. He stressed that we are not talking about the transfer of tactical nuclear weapons to Minsk. The United States , European Union and Great Britain condemned this decision.
